Historical Overview: The History and Evolution of Red Dot Sights

The Birth of Red Dot Sights

Red dot sights first emerged in the early 1970s, revolutionizing the way shooters aimed at their targets. Before red dots, most shooters relied on iron sights or scopes, which could be cumbersome and slow to use. You might find it interesting that the initial designs were quite basic, primarily used by hunters and sport shooters. These early models featured simple illuminated reticles projected onto a lens. Despite their simplicity, they marked the beginning of a new era in sighting technology.

The first commercially successful red dot sight was introduced by Aimpoint in 1975. This model, known as the Aimpoint Electronic, was groundbreaking. It featured a battery-powered LED that projected a red dot onto a lens. Shooters were thrilled with how easy it was to acquire targets quickly. You can imagine the excitement as this new technology began to spread among enthusiasts. The Aimpoint Electronic paved the way for future innovations and established the red dot sight as a viable tool for marksmen.

Red Dot Sights in the 1980s and 1990s

The 1980s and 1990s saw significant advancements in red dot technology. During this time, manufacturers focused on improving durability and battery life. Red dots became more reliable and user-friendly, appealing to a broader range of shooters, including law enforcement and military personnel. You might be surprised to learn that these improvements made red dots a popular choice for tactical applications.

One notable advancement was the introduction of the reflex sight, which used a collimated light source and a reflective lens. This design eliminated parallax errors and allowed for both-eyes-open shooting, greatly enhancing situational awareness. You can appreciate how this innovation made red dots even more practical for dynamic shooting situations. Reflex sights quickly gained popularity and remain a staple in the world of red dots.

During this period, the competition among manufacturers led to a variety of models with different features. For instance, EOTech introduced holographic sights, which projected a reticle onto a holographic film. This technology offered an even clearer sight picture and was particularly effective in low-light conditions. You might enjoy exploring the differences between holographic and traditional red dot sights, as each has unique benefits.

Red Dot Sights Enter the New Millennium

As we entered the 2000s, red dot sights continued to evolve at a rapid pace. Advances in electronics and optics allowed for smaller, more efficient designs. You might have noticed how red dots have become more compact and lightweight, making them ideal for modern firearms. This period also saw the introduction of variable brightness settings, which enabled users to adjust the reticle intensity based on ambient light conditions.

One of the most significant developments was the incorporation of automatic brightness adjustment. This feature uses sensors to detect light levels and adjust the reticle brightness accordingly. Imagine how convenient it is to have a red dot that automatically adapts to changing environments! This innovation has made red dots even more user-friendly and effective in diverse lighting conditions.

In recent years, red dot sights have become more affordable, allowing more shooters to experience their benefits. You can find a wide range of options, from budget-friendly models to high-end, feature-rich sights. This accessibility has made red dots a common sight on everything from handguns to rifles and shotguns. The versatility of red dots continues to be one of their most appealing features.

Enhanced Battery Life

If you’ve ever been out in the field and had your red dot sight’s battery die, you know how frustrating it can be. Fortunately, recent advancements in battery technology have made this much less of an issue. Modern red dot sights now come with significantly enhanced battery life, some lasting up to 50,000 hours on a single battery. That’s over five years of continuous use! You won’t have to worry about your sight dying on you at a critical moment. Some models even feature solar panels to extend battery life further, so you can rely on natural sunlight to keep your sight powered up.

Shake Awake Technology

Another fantastic innovation is shake awake technology. This feature ensures that your red dot sight is always ready when you need it. When the sight detects motion, it automatically powers on. If it remains motionless for a set period, it powers down to conserve battery life. You’ll appreciate how this technology makes your red dot sight both convenient and energy-efficient. No more fumbling with switches when you need to react quickly. Just pick up your firearm, and your sight is ready to go. It’s a small but significant upgrade that adds to the overall reliability of your gear.

Parallax-Free Design

Modern red dot sights have also made significant strides in eliminating parallax. Parallax can cause your reticle to appear to move slightly when you shift your head position, which can affect your accuracy. Parallax-free red dot sights ensure that the reticle remains fixed on the target regardless of your head position. This advancement provides you with a consistent and reliable aiming point, improving your overall shooting precision. You’ll find it much easier to maintain accuracy, even in dynamic shooting situations where you might not always have a perfect cheek weld.

Impact on Tactical Gear: How Red Dot Sight Technology Has Changed Tactical Operations

Faster Target Acquisition

One of the most significant impacts of red dot technology on tactical operations is the speed of target acquisition. Traditional iron sights require you to align the front and rear sights, which can be time-consuming in high-stress situations. Red dot sights simplify this process by providing a single aiming point. You just place the dot on the target and pull the trigger. This ability to quickly acquire targets can be a game-changer in tactical scenarios where every second counts. You’ll appreciate how much faster and more efficient your responses become with a red dot sight.

Improved Accuracy

Accuracy is crucial in tactical operations, and red dot technology has made a substantial difference in this area. The illuminated reticle provides a clear, precise aiming point, even in low-light conditions. Unlike traditional sights, which can be challenging to use in dim environments, red dots ensure you can see your target and reticle clearly. You’ll find that your shot placement improves significantly, reducing the likelihood of missed shots and collateral damage. The consistency of the red dot reticle helps maintain accuracy, making you more effective in the field.

Enhanced Situational Awareness

Situational awareness is vital for tactical operators, and red dot sights contribute significantly to this aspect. With a red dot sight, you can keep both eyes open while aiming, which allows you to maintain a broader field of view. This ability to see your surroundings while focusing on your target enhances your situational awareness, helping you identify potential threats more quickly. You’ll find that you can respond to multiple targets or changing conditions more effectively. This improvement in awareness can make a critical difference in complex tactical scenarios.
